1920s British Straight Sending Morse Key Possibly Made By Walters
This morse key is an, approximately, 1920s British Straight Sending Morse Key Possibly Made By Walters. Made predominantly from brass with some steel, the ensemble sits on a wooden base.
Approximate Size:
- Base Width: 14.4
- Height: 4.5 cm
- Base Depth: 7.4 cm
- Length of Key: 11.4 cm
I'm unable to find a maker's mark but it is very similar in design to the Walters Straight Keys used by the British GPO.
In fairly good condition, it does have wear on the brass, and some scratches on the wood.
